Understanding Silica Fume and Its Manufacturers


Silica fume, also known as microsilica, is a byproduct of silicon and ferrosilicon metal production. It consists of very fine particles, typically less than 1 micron in size, and it has a high silica content (around 85-98%). This material has garnered significant attention in the construction and engineering industry due to its unique properties and benefits. As a result, silica fume manufacturers have become vital players in the production of high-performance concrete and other construction materials.


The Role of Silica Fume in the Construction Industry


One of the most significant uses of silica fume is as a pozzolanic material in concrete. When added to concrete, it reacts with calcium hydroxide produced during the hydration of cement, resulting in increased durability and strength. This reaction enhances the mechanical properties of concrete, leading to improved compressive strength, reduced permeability, and greater resistance to chemical attack. Consequently, structures built with silica fume concrete often exhibit extended service life and require less maintenance.


Silica fume is also beneficial in reducing the heat of hydration, making it suitable for massive structures where temperature control is critical. Additionally, cement manufacturers use silica fume to create high-performance grouts, self-compacting concrete, and other specialized products. As urban construction continues to rise, the demand for advanced materials like silica fume is expected to increase.


Choosing the Right Silica Fume Manufacturer


Selecting the right silica fume manufacturer is crucial for ensuring the quality and performance of construction materials. Here are several factors to consider

1. Quality Standards A reputable manufacturer should adhere to stringent quality control measures and comply with industry standards. Look for certifications such as ISO 9001, which indicates a commitment to quality management.


2. Technical Support A good manufacturer will provide technical support, assisting customers with mix designs and application methods to maximize the benefits of silica fume in their projects.


3. Product Range Manufacturers often offer various grades of silica fume, tailored for specific applications. Ensure that they provide the type and grade that meet your project requirements.


4. Experience and Reputation A long-standing presence in the industry is often indicative of a manufacturer's reliability and expertise. Research customer reviews, case studies, and referrals to gauge the reputation of potential suppliers.


5. Sustainability Practices As environmental concerns grow, many construction projects prioritize sustainability. Choose a manufacturer that employs environmentally friendly practices in the production of silica fume.
